在debian操作系统中,swagger的日志记录方式通常依赖于运行在其上的应用服务器(例如spring boot)所具备的日志功能。虽然swagger本身不会直接生成日志信息,但其用户界面(swagger ui)的访问行为会被应用服务器记录下来。以下是用于查看和管理swagger相关日志的具体步骤:
-
查看系统日志: 使用命令 tail -f /var/log/syslog 来实时查看最新的系统日志内容,这些日志涵盖了系统的启动、关闭以及各类服务的运行状态和错误信息。如果需要更深入的内核日志信息,可以使用 dmesg 或者 journalctl 命令。
-
检查应用程序服务器日志: 明确你的应用服务器(如spring boot)是否已经配置了日志记录机制。对于Spring Boot项目,日志文件通常存放在 /var/log/ 目录下,常见的文件名包括 application.log 或 nohup.out,具体取决于你当前的设置。
-
使用日志查看工具: 可以通过 tail 命令来动态查看日志文件的内容,示例命令如下:
tail -f /var/log/application.log
-
搜索特定内容: 如果你需要查找与Swagger有关的信息,可以通过 grep 命令对日志进行筛选,比如:
grep -i "swagger" /var/log/application.log
-
调整Swagger相关配置: 如果发现Swagger存在配置问题,建议检查 swagger.yaml 或 swagger.json 配置文件,确保其中的设置无误。
-
查阅官方文档: 推荐参考Swagger的官方文档,学习如何正确地配置与使用该工具。
遵循上述步骤,你将能够在Debian系统中有效地管理和记录Swagger相关的日志内容,为后续的故障诊断和系统维护提供便利。